What's the Sussex Mayor?
The Sussex Mayor is a new role being introduced by the Government for May 2026 along with new councils.
The new mayor will bring together councils across Brighton & Hove and East and West Sussex.
The Mayor will have powers for transport, the economy, planning and housing and more from Chichester to Rye and everywhere in between, including Brighton & Hove.

About Ben Dempsey
A Local Champion for Sussex
Ben Dempsey grew up in Haywards Heath and has lived in Sussex for most of his life. He now works on UK nature restoration for a large wildlife organisation and has a PhD in nature conservation from the University of Sussex.
He was previously a senior leader in humanitarian organisations, including Save the Children, managing major budgets, leading teams and working in conflict zones such as Gaza.
Ben has served as a Mid Sussex District Councillor. He now lives in Ditchling with his children and his wife, who is an NHS doctor. A Brighton & Hove Albion supporter, he enjoys walking on the Downs with his golden retriever, Alba.
